Land grading services involve the careful shaping and leveling of a property's terrain to achieve proper drainage, stability, and an even surface. This process typically includes removing excess soil, filling low spots, and contouring the land to ensure water flows away from structures and prevents pooling or erosion. Proper grading is essential for preparing a site for construction, landscaping, or lawn installation, helping to establish a solid foundation for future development or aesthetic enhancements.
One of the primary issues land grading addresses is water drainage. Poorly graded properties can experience water accumulation, which may lead to foundation problems, basement flooding, or landscape erosion. By establishing a gentle slope away from buildings and other structures, grading services help mitigate these risks. Additionally, land grading can resolve issues related to uneven terrain, such as preventing soil erosion on slopes or creating a stable surface for installing driveways, patios, or lawns.

The overview below groups typical Land Grading proj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Flowery Branch,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Land Grading - Typ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for small to medium projects. This includes leveling and contouring the land to prepare for landscaping or construction. Costs can vary based on the size and complexity of the area.
Moderate Land Grading - Usually ranges from $3,000 to $7,000 for larger or more detailed grading work. This may involve additional excavation, drainage setup, and slope adjustments. Example projects include yard renovations or foundation prep.
Heavy Land Grading - Can cost $7,000 to $15,000 or more depending on the scope. This includes significant earthmoving, grading for large developments, or site leveling for commercial projects. Costs depend on soil conditions and project size.
Additional Costs - Extra charges may apply for soil removal, fill material, or dealing with difficult terrain. These can add several hundred to thousands of dollars to the overall cost, depending on specific site conditions.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
